@ ctrlaltv
1. Do you have .htaccess enabled? If yes - check if you have no any syntax errors in it. If not, skip this point. If you don't know what am I talking about - you have not.
2. Do you have a 500 error only on your index file or on any other file, too? If only on your php pages, but (in example) images you can see without a problem - check if you don't have any errors, infinite loops etc. in your code. If you have 500 error on any file, even on images or simple text files - create a new separate topic with the subject line: "[admin] 500 error", provide your 110mb subdomain name and the information that you have 500 error and wait for admin responce. Additionally check your mail box if you have no any mail from 110mb.
